Jade itself comes in two main varieties: jadeite and nephrite. Jadeite is the more precious of the two, known for its vibrant colors and rarity. It’s available in a range of hues, but the most valuable is imperial jade, a brilliant green that commands high prices. Nephrite, on the other hand, is more common and often found in green, yellow, or white. Despite being less rare, nephrite is more durable than jadeite, making it a practical choice for everyday wear.
